Learn to recognize different quality of woods. Some furniture is made from solid wood, which is a lot more expensive and fragile. Veneers are basically made from a low quality wood base covered in layers of real wood. The cheapest wood furniture you will find is made from resin, plastic and wood scraps.

Good furniture is usually expensive. That means used is usually a good deal. You can find used furniture that is in terrific condition from places such as online advertisements, garage sales or consignment shops. After you purchase the furniture, just get it reupholstered. This will end up saving you lots of money.

Don’t think twice about haggling with someone selling furniture. The majority of furniture stores mark up their furniture significantly; by negotiating, you can get a discount as high as twenty percent. If you are not comfortable with haggling, find a friend or a relative who can come shopping with you.

Read all color description before buying any furniture from online. many times people select furniture based on the way that it looks. In many cases people that do this end up with mismatched furniture. A brown loveseat with a black chair won’t look so good, so read the descriptions thoroughly.

If you need several pieces of furniture, look for package deals. You will find that many times a store will give you a much better price for buying many pieces. If there are no posted deals, be sure to share with your salesperson the fact that you want many pieces and ask if they can give you a deal.

Prior to heading out to the store, think through what you need. Write down the items you have to buy and which room they are going to be in. Also make note if you think any colors or patterns would be nice. The list can help save you a lot of time and money once you actually get to the store.

If you are shopping for an entire room of furniture, ask about quantity discounts. Many stores will offer them. If they are not willing to discount the price, ask if they will throw in small extras, like a lamp or end table, to make the deal a better one.

Make sure you take measurements before you go out to shop for furniture. You need to make sure the piece you fall in love with in the showroom is actually going to fit in your home. Having a list of the measurements of your space can ensure you do not accidentally purchase an item that is way too big to fit.
